The step to solve 4x2-13=3

OpenStudy (anonymous):

solve for x^2 and the take the square root

OpenStudy (anonymous):

then

OpenStudy (anonymous):

Transfer 13 to RHS and divide the equation by 4 You get x^2 = 16/4 i.e x^2=4 Take square root on both sides. The answer is x=2 or x=-2
